Technical Description
The HM 163.42 accessory is intended to enable the user to investigate the behaviour of waves on a rising beach; the unit is used in combination with the HM 163.41 Wave Generator. The stainless steel experimental arrangement forms a smooth, impermeable beach. The inclination of the beach body can be continuously adjusted. In this way different steeply rising beaches are very easy to simulate. The experimental layout consists of a beach body, a mounting plate and an inclination adjustment bar with a locking bolt.
Learning Objectives / Experiments
· Investigation of the propagation of waves with varying water depth
· Investigation of deep and shallow water waves over a smooth, impermeable beach
· Investigation of different breaker types
· Energy transport in a wave
